The Seattle Seahawks announced the signing of undrafted rookie wide receiver Nate McCollum, according to team reporter Brady Henderson. McCollum participated in the New York Giants' rookie camp earlier this month but is now getting a shot with a second organization. McCollum began his career at Georgia Tech and played three seasons for the Yellow Jackets before two years with North Carolina. Overall, he tallied 143 receptions for 1,521 yards and five touchdowns in 49 career games. It would be a surprise if McCollum is on the fantasy football radar in 2025, and he'll likely have an uphill battle to make the team's active roster.
